I too was a Super High Mileage contestant back in the day.

No, you can't take the competition cars and drive them on the streets and get that fe, and you can't directly lift the tech on to your street vehicles, but that doesn't nullify the contest. It's a great project engineering/coordination/planning/execution experience, and it's interesting, fun, and engaging besides.

Shell does have a "real street" category that still isn't real street... I don't quite understand that one yet...
